Botanists study how plants make foodstuff And the way to enhance yields, as an example by way of plant breeding, building their perform crucial that you humanity's capacity to feed the globe and supply meals security for foreseeable future generations.[72] Botanists also study weeds, which can be a considerable issue in agriculture, and the biology and Charge of plant pathogens in agriculture and organic ecosystems.[73] Ethnobotany may be the examine on the interactions between plants and people.

Several of the glucose is transformed to starch that is stored during the chloroplast.[81] Starch is definitely the characteristic Strength shop of most land plants and algae, though inulin, a polymer of fructose is used for the same goal while in the sunflower loved ones Asteraceae. Several of the glucose is transformed to sucrose (prevalent table sugar) for export to the rest of the plant.
